Essential Read

The Road To Wigan Pier
by George Orwell

















Briefing notes: The first half of the tome presents Orwell's insights into the existence of the working class living in the the industrial towns of Northern England in the years before the outbreak of World War Two. The second, explores Orwell's own beliefs and thoughts on socialism. The themes touched upon in the prose have remained relevant to life since its publication and perhaps in this current moment in time, more relevant than ever.

Kit List

Penny Loafer (slip-ons)

Briefing notes:  American east coast heritage. Compliment practically any type of suit, considered to be too casual for black tie and morning suit occasions. Can be black, ox-blood, brown, suede or tasselled. Manufacturers recommended include Crockett & Jones and Edward Green.

Kit List

Socks

Briefing notes: Wool, cashmere, silk or cotton. Hand linked toe to avoid discomfort. Plain or subtle pattern. No cartoon characters, slogans etc. I recommend two manufacturers Scott-Nichol and Pantharella. Both make in Britain and their offerings are of the highest quality.
